Ticket #55707 – Description
initial v2 2 2 3 3 krb5.conf has noaddresses = false, and doesn't list a kdc. In this situation Kerberos will discover the KDC from DNS. The discovery works fine for kinit. But if you try ssh you get an error. This error does not occur with noaddresses true, or if the kdc is specified.
